Support Services News
An important community presentation on internet safety will be held on Tuesday, May 12th at 6:00 p.m. at the Mohave District Annex. The event is open to parents, community members, school administrators, educators, and district staff.
The session is presented in partnership with the Phoenix Field Office of the Federal Bureau of Investigation. It is designed to provide timely information about current online risks facing youth and to equip adults with practical tools to help keep children safe in an increasingly digital world.

Any SUSD family member needing social/emotional assistance is encouraged to contact Shannon Cronn, Director of Support Services.
Partial list of resources available in our community:
- 988 Suicide and Crisis Hotline
- Teen Lifeline: Call 24/7 or Text 602-248-8336
- Crisis Text Line: Text “Home” to 742741
- Crisis Response Network: 602-222-9444
- Scottsdale Police Crisis Team: 480-312-5055
- The Disaster Distress Hotline: 1-800-985-5990 or Text TalkWithUs to 66746
- National Parent Helpline: 1-855-4-A-PARENT (1-855-427-2736)
- Vista Del Camino (City of Scottsdale Food Bank): 480-312-2323
- UMOM: https://umom.org/find-help/
- Family Housing Hub: 602-595-8700
- Youth Resource Center (For People Aged 18-24 Years Old): 480-868-7527
- Arizona 211: Call 2-1-1 or visit https://211arizona.org/
- Arizona Food Bank Network: www.azfoodbanks.org
